TIM_TypeDef Struct Reference
[Peripheral_registers_structures]

TIM. More...

#include <stm32f10x.h>

Data Fields

__IO uint16_t ARR
__IO uint16_t BDTR
__IO uint16_t CCER
__IO uint16_t CCMR1
__IO uint16_t CCMR2
__IO uint16_t CCR1
__IO uint16_t CCR2
__IO uint16_t CCR3
__IO uint16_t CCR4
__IO uint16_t CNT
__IO uint16_t CR1
__IO uint16_t CR2
__IO uint16_t DCR
__IO uint16_t DIER
__IO uint16_t DMAR
__IO uint16_t EGR
__IO uint16_t PSC
__IO uint16_t RCR
uint16_t RESERVED0
uint16_t RESERVED1
uint16_t RESERVED10
uint16_t RESERVED11
uint16_t RESERVED12
uint16_t RESERVED13
uint16_t RESERVED14
uint16_t RESERVED15
uint16_t RESERVED16
uint16_t RESERVED17
uint16_t RESERVED18
uint16_t RESERVED19
uint16_t RESERVED2
uint16_t RESERVED3
uint16_t RESERVED4
uint16_t RESERVED5
uint16_t RESERVED6
uint16_t RESERVED7
uint16_t RESERVED8
uint16_t RESERVED9
__IO uint16_t SMCR
__IO uint16_t SR

Detailed Description

TIM.

Definition at line 1169 of file stm32f10x.h.


Field Documentation

__IO uint16_t TIM_TypeDef::ARR

Definition at line 1193 of file stm32f10x.h.

Referenced by TIM_SetAutoreload(), and TIM_TimeBaseInit().

__IO uint16_t TIM_TypeDef::BDTR

Definition at line 1205 of file stm32f10x.h.

Referenced by TIM_BDTRConfig(), and TIM_CtrlPWMOutputs().

__IO uint16_t TIM_TypeDef::CCER
__IO uint16_t TIM_TypeDef::CCMR1
__IO uint16_t TIM_TypeDef::CCMR2
__IO uint16_t TIM_TypeDef::CCR1

Definition at line 1197 of file stm32f10x.h.

Referenced by TIM_GetCapture1(), TIM_OC1Init(), and TIM_SetCompare1().

__IO uint16_t TIM_TypeDef::CCR2

Definition at line 1199 of file stm32f10x.h.

Referenced by TIM_GetCapture2(), TIM_OC2Init(), and TIM_SetCompare2().

__IO uint16_t TIM_TypeDef::CCR3

Definition at line 1201 of file stm32f10x.h.

Referenced by TIM_GetCapture3(), TIM_OC3Init(), and TIM_SetCompare3().

__IO uint16_t TIM_TypeDef::CCR4

Definition at line 1203 of file stm32f10x.h.

Referenced by TIM_GetCapture4(), TIM_OC4Init(), and TIM_SetCompare4().

__IO uint16_t TIM_TypeDef::CNT

Definition at line 1189 of file stm32f10x.h.

Referenced by TIM_GetCounter(), and TIM_SetCounter().

__IO uint16_t TIM_TypeDef::CR1
__IO uint16_t TIM_TypeDef::CR2
__IO uint16_t TIM_TypeDef::DCR

Definition at line 1207 of file stm32f10x.h.

Referenced by TIM_DMAConfig().

__IO uint16_t TIM_TypeDef::DIER

Definition at line 1177 of file stm32f10x.h.

Referenced by TIM_DMACmd(), TIM_GetITStatus(), and TIM_ITConfig().

__IO uint16_t TIM_TypeDef::DMAR

Definition at line 1209 of file stm32f10x.h.

__IO uint16_t TIM_TypeDef::EGR

Definition at line 1181 of file stm32f10x.h.

Referenced by TIM_GenerateEvent(), TIM_PrescalerConfig(), and TIM_TimeBaseInit().

__IO uint16_t TIM_TypeDef::PSC

Definition at line 1191 of file stm32f10x.h.

Referenced by TIM_GetPrescaler(), TIM_PrescalerConfig(), and TIM_TimeBaseInit().

__IO uint16_t TIM_TypeDef::RCR

Definition at line 1195 of file stm32f10x.h.

Referenced by TIM_TimeBaseInit().

Definition at line 1172 of file stm32f10x.h.

Definition at line 1174 of file stm32f10x.h.

Definition at line 1192 of file stm32f10x.h.

Definition at line 1194 of file stm32f10x.h.

Definition at line 1196 of file stm32f10x.h.

Definition at line 1198 of file stm32f10x.h.

Definition at line 1200 of file stm32f10x.h.

Definition at line 1202 of file stm32f10x.h.

Definition at line 1204 of file stm32f10x.h.

Definition at line 1206 of file stm32f10x.h.

Definition at line 1208 of file stm32f10x.h.

Definition at line 1210 of file stm32f10x.h.

Definition at line 1176 of file stm32f10x.h.

Definition at line 1178 of file stm32f10x.h.

Definition at line 1180 of file stm32f10x.h.

Definition at line 1182 of file stm32f10x.h.

Definition at line 1184 of file stm32f10x.h.

Definition at line 1186 of file stm32f10x.h.

Definition at line 1188 of file stm32f10x.h.

Definition at line 1190 of file stm32f10x.h.

__IO uint16_t TIM_TypeDef::SMCR
__IO uint16_t TIM_TypeDef::SR

The documentation for this struct was generated from the following file:
STM32F10x Standard Peripherals Library: Footer

 

 

 

      For complete documentation on STM32(CORTEX M3) 32-bit Microcontrollers platform visit  www.st.com/STM32